It was 4 degrees F this am.  I just received my 18-50 Sigma f 2.8 Zoom.  I must admit, I am amazed at the build quality, light weight, smooth zoom operation and the image quality.  Really quite sharp at f 2.8 and there doesn't seem to be much need to  go up in f stops other than for greater depth of field.  The color rendition is just fine.  Of course I am stuck inside due to the temperature, this is just one of the first test shots I took while strolling  around the house.

 

Leica CL, 18-50 Sigma f 5.6, ISO 200, 1/40th
